The cheapest way to get from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or is to bus and line 702 bus which costs £6 - £8 and takes 3h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or is to drive which takes 42 min and costs £6 - £10.
No, there is no direct bus from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or. However, there are services departing from Highgate and arriving at Legoland Park & Ride via Camden Town Station and High Street Kensington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 26m.
The distance between Highgate Underground Station and Legoland Windsor is 31 miles. The road distance is 28.5 miles.
The best way to get from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or without a car is to subway and train which takes 1h 49m and costs £17 - £29.
It takes approximately 1h 49m to get from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or, including transfers.
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or bus services, operated by Abellio London, depart from Camden Town Station.
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or bus services, operated by Abellio London, arrive at High Street Kensington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or is 29 miles. It takes approximately 42 min to drive from Highgate Underground Station to Legoland Windsor.
